Buying Rear Lamps Safely
Internet shopping is quick and convenient - and it should be trustworthy and dependable, in the event that you buy products from an approved retailer.
Much like handing over your mastercard to a waiter or getting gasoline at the gas station, as long as you practice some important guidelines shopping on the web is safe.
But take it easy to start with, before begin purchasing on the Internet there are a number of questions you must think through.
- Can the retailer be relied on? Look for corporations who're a part of an independent approval scheme. Many of these are corporations which have signed up to precise principles.
- Have they got a 'secure' server?
Try to find internet sites which use a safe method of paying (often known as an encryption facility) - most of these clearly display a padlock along the lower edge of the display screen while you're entering the payment ?nformation. Almost all E-commerce web pages employ a kind of shopping cart application. That is a digital trolley inside which you can place items, before heading to the check out the stage where you will be able to buy your purchases. The check out should be on a secure server to ensure that your financial transaction remains safe and secure. - How can you speak to them in case the purchase should go drastically wrong?
You should always know the retailers's actual location - this is especially true if the retailer is located outside your country. The web makes purchasing from abroad straightforward and so it is important that you know your protection under the law. Do not assume a web trader is based within the United kingdom because their web address ends in a 'uk'. Find out more about the bricks-and-mortar location and phone number. Though buying from offshore web sites is comparatively safe would possibly be impossible to use legal action based on your contract if complications occur. If the item cost much more than £100 then think about the benefits of settling by visa card. - Check out whether or not the company provides a privacy declaration which tells you just what it'll do with all your confidential data.
Your Legal Rights
Consistent with the UK Distance Selling Regulations, internet retailers must:
- Supply you with clear information relating to the merchandise on offer in advance.
- Supply paper order confirmation
- Will offer you a 'cooling off' interval in which you can easlily make your mind up to stop the contract without any reason within seven days of receiving the products and be able to receive a complete reimbursement
- Offer you a full repayment if the products do not show up by the agreed delivery day (or inside 30 days in the event that no delivery date was first advised).
- If required, the vendor will need to reimburse clients inside a selected period of time.
- Carry out the contract in full within a reasonable time period.
Applicable Legislation.
In case your Rear Lamps transaction is not protected by UK law, you ought to check out the corresponding restrictions for the legal system which does apply.
Moreover, know that the United Kingdom distance selling laws don't apply to online auctions, but they do affect fixed price products and services offered for sale via online auction websites.
